Concurrency control has received considerable attention in multidatabase systems because of their characteristics such as heterogeneity and autonomy. Particulary, various concurrency control protocols have been developped in the litterature. In this paper, we present a protocol that guarantees the two level serializability criterion and built up according to the topdown approach.

Most speaker diarization systems fit into one of two categories: bottom-up or top-down. Bottom-up systems are the most popular but can sometimes suffer from instability from merging and stopping criteria difficulties.
